“服务器不能轻易给别人”这句话的意思可能有多种理解,具体取决于上下文。以下是几种常见的解释和原因:
1. 安全角度:服务器资源不能随意分享
服务器是承载网站、应用、数据库等重要服务的核心设备,通常包含敏感数据或关键业务逻辑。
原因:
- 防止数据泄露:服务器中可能存储用户信息、商业机密、源代码等敏感内容。
- 避免被攻击利用:如果别人获得了服务器访问权限,可能会用来进行恶意操作(如植入木马、发起DDoS攻击等)。
- 系统稳定性风险:他人误操作可能导致服务崩溃、数据丢失。
- 合规性要求:很多行业对数据安全有严格规定(如GDPR、等保2.0),擅自分享服务器可能违反法规。
2. 技术角度:服务器配置不宜随便共享
如果你指的是把服务器的访问权限(比如SSH账号、密码、API密钥)给他人使用,也存在以下问题:
原因:
- 权限难以控制:你无法精确限制对方能做什么操作。
- 日志追踪困难:多个用户共用一个账号时,出现问题难以追责。
- 资源滥用风险:别人可能运行占用大量CPU、内存的任务,影响你的正常使用。
3. 法律与责任角度
如果你将服务器提供给他人用于非法用途(如搭建违规网站、资源站、X_X、等),你也可能承担连带法律责任。
如何安全地“分享”服务器能力?(如果你确实需要让别人使用服务器资源)
| 场景 | 推荐做法 |
|---|---|
| 合作开发项目 | 使用版本控制系统(如Git)、分配独立账号、使用容器隔离环境(如Docker) |
| 提供Web服务 | 通过域名绑定、反向等方式隔离服务,不开放整台服务器访问权限 |
| 给他人测试环境 | 使用虚拟机或容器创建隔离的子环境,限制资源使用 |
| 分配临时访问权限 | 使用一次性SSH密钥、设置访问有效期、使用跳板机 |
总结一句话:
服务器是重要的数字资产,不应随意交给他人使用,除非采取了严格的权限控制和安全保障措施。
如果你能提供更多上下文(比如你是开发者、运维人员,还是普通用户),我可以给出更具体的建议。
CLOUD技术博